> i agree w/ the other poster that Medusa is the better choice,
IMHO it depends. AFAIK the web application has to behave well.
Therefore it does not make sense to deploy Medusa if your
application has to wait for long-lasting blocking I/O operations
(like slow database connection with only synchronous API calls).
And AFAIK using traditional CGI-BIN programs also needs forking
under Medusa. You're lost on Win98...
Or did I get something wrong?
